Fiber Project Manager

Role Overview
The Fiber Project Manager leads field teams and manages the full lifecycle of fiber optic network projects, including new site development and facility modifications. This role balances direct personnel leadership with high-level project strategy, financial oversight, and quality control.

Key Responsibilities

  • Project Leadership: Oversee fiber engineering, fiber construction inspection, and data collection. Manage project pace, mitigate risks, and ensure all deliverables meet QA/QC standards.
  • Financial Management: Own the project’s financial health, including P&L reviews, budget adherence, revenue recognition, and accounts receivable.
  • Team Management: Supervise internal staff, lead status meetings, and identify performance improvements. Invest in the team through mentorship and specialized training.
  • Stakeholder Coordination: Act as the primary liaison between internal departments, external vendors (CAD, surveys, etc.), and clients to ensure scope alignment and professional representation.
  • Technical Oversight: Assist with complex design assignments and employ advanced analytics to solve field and engineering challenges.

Qualifications

  • Experience: 5 + years in fiber engineering with a proven record of success across multiple client settings.
  • Education: BS in Engineering or advanced degree preferred.
  • Technical Skills: Deep knowledge of Fiber design (site acquisition, permitting, GIS, aerial pole surveys, and cable placement). FTTH, FTTP
  • Tools: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and Sitetracker.
  • Soft Skills: Strong public speaking, presentation, and written communication skills. Ability to work independently under stringent deadlines.
  • Requirements: Must be willing to travel and perform field work as required.
